Patent number: 9579467Abstract: A safety needle device comprising a needle hub, an attachment mechanism arranged at the distal end for attaching the safety needle device to a medicament container, and a coaxially arranged needle attachment member. The safety needle device also comprises an injection needle comprising a proximal pointed injection end and a distal pointed non-injection end arranged to penetrate a septum of a medicament container, the injection needle being attached inside the needle hub and extending through the needle attachment member. A rotator arranged to rotate on the hub, the rotator arranged with an annular wall provided with a central passage, such that the needle attachment member of the needle hub extends through a central passage of the rotator. A needle shield surrounds the rotator and slidably arranged with respect to the hub and the rotator.Type: GrantFiled: June 10, 2014Date of Patent: February 28, 2017Assignee: SHL Group ABInventor: Sebastian Karlsson

Patent number: 9446201Abstract: A medicament delivery device has proximal and distal housing parts connected along a longitudinal axis, the proximal part for accommodating a medicament container. A drive member inside the distal part has a first circumferential set of interacting devices. A longitudinal plunger rod is rotationally locked through a central passage of the distal part, acts on a stopper inside the container, and is connected to the plunger rod. A turnable dose setting member coaxially arranged around the drive member is rotatably connected to the distal part. A torsion spring is connected to the dose setting member and to a hub of the drive member. The hub, spring, dose setting member, and drive member are coaxial transversally. The drive nut has second interacting devices on its outer surface. When the drive member is rotated by the spring, the drive nut rotates, whereby the plunger rod moves proximally for expelling a dose of medicament.Type: GrantFiled: April 14, 2011Date of Patent: September 20, 2016Assignee: SHL Group ABInventor: Anders Holmqvist
